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Estate La Colina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Estate La Colina with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Estate La Colina is at Lakeview at the Bay listed at $950.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Estate La Colina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Estate La Colina is $1,572.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Estate La Colina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Estate La Colina is a 1,054 square feet unit starting from $1,699 at San Palmas.
What is the average size for Estate La Colina 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Estate La Colina is currently 725 sq ft.
